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5862625 6803699 875531765 757183023 2292
5878832396 28325 62551495101
5878832396 28325 62551495101
6685881 3545 668 91738
All about undefined
Interested in learning more?
5878832396 28325 62551495101
6685881 3545 668 91738
See more
273459135 4474386
42446 77312633859 14868165
See more
98 3672
569513 169 645945 846843
See more